Following two spectacular performances at this year's edition of Prophecy Fest last weekend, Darkher, the sole brainchild and solo-project of Northern English singer and guitarist Jayn Maiven, offers four more golden opportunities to witness her musical magic live on stage. This includes two back-to-back shows in her native Yorkshire with special guests such as My Dying Bride's vocalist Aaron Stainthorpe and the Dead Space Chamber Music ensemble (see below for all currently confirmed concert dates).
Darkher will be performing live in support of her acclaimed latest masterpiece, The Buried Storm, released in April 2022 on Prophecy Productions. Link
Darkher - live:
10 OCT 2025 Nijmegen (NL) Doornroosje, Soulcrusher Festival
18 OCT 2025 Hebden Bridge (UK) The Trades Club with Aaron Stainthorpe & Dead Space Chamber Music
19 OCT 2025 Hebden Bridge (UK) Heptonstall Octagonal Chapel with Ellen Southern (DSCM)
08 NOV 2025 London (UK) The Black Heart with Dead Space Chamber Music
